Back to the grind.

May 27, 2010 justTUX

So I went back on placement today. I was so glad to be going back but at the same time I was really nervous about how I would cope. I have found since being discharged I am unusually tired and getting much more shortness of breath. I knew I had to go back and did… Continue reading Back to the grind.
